What is OpenSea? Week 1 Nft Lines
OpenSea provides a platform for non-fungible currency, also known as NFTs. Through their decentralized marketplace, users can purchase, sell NFTs, trade them, and exchange them with other users.
The NFTs that are available aren’t limited to music, art game items, domain names.
It was established in the year 2018 in 2018 by Devin Finzer and Alex Atallah Two programmers who got started by helping facilitate the first generation of digital collectible items. It was also among the very first NFT marketplaces, a concept that is as new as cryptocurrencies.
Today, it is one of the largest NFT marketplaces. They have an extensive collection of NFTs which is constantly expanding. The most appealing aspect of these is that they permit users to list NFTs bought or created elsewhere.
What is the process behind OpenSea operate?
If you’ve ever been trading or buying cryptocurrencies and NFT, you’ll notice NFT trading very similar.
For OpenSea, all of the assets that are listed on the platform are owned by users, not the platform. Because they’re an open marketplace, they have intelligent contracts so that users can interact with potential buyers without risking their NFT ownership.
That means unless the transaction is completed the digital assets won’t leave your wallet. In addition, you don’t have to make your account. All you have to do is have a web3 supported wallet.
If you’re a buyer, you can use their browser to look for NFTs you’d like to purchase. They also have filters available to simplify your search.

What are the options for selling?
Selling on OpenSea is simple. All you have to do is list them on the marketplace. It’s all you have to do is ensure that your wallet is connected. Once you’ve added the price and type of auction and you’re ready to go.
If you are a first-time seller, you will be subjected to a one-time gas fee.
Currently, you can choose from five options for selling. The choices are:
Fixed Price
The seller is the one to pay the cost of the NFT. Just as the name suggests, it never changes.
Dutch Auction
For an auction like the Dutch Auction, the seller decides on a price which will fall over time. Sellers typically set up very expensive prices. As time passes, the price decreases until it’s comparable to the price the buyer is willing to pay. In addition, buyers can present an offer. The NFT can be sold when they reach an agreement on the price.
English Auction
The seller puts up an NFT for sale and will list an amount that is a minimum. This is different from that of the Dutch Auction, where the price decreases with time. In the English Auction, buyers will bidding until the seller sells the auction to the highest bidder.
OpenSea can automatically take over the bid if the auction ends above 1 Etherium.

Are there any charges?
It’s normal for crypto or NFT marketplaces to impose charges for using the platform. While the fee charged varies according to the platform, it’s generally a percentage of the sale cost paid by the buyer. Similar to how regular galleries make money by gaining a percentage of the paintings that are sold.
With OpenSea you only need to pay 2.5% when you purchase an NFT. There are no listing fees and other kinds of charges. Other marketplaces charge you a 5% per sale, which makes OpenSea’s 2.5 per cent fee affordable.
However, you must know that certain NFTs have higher transaction charges as compared to other. It is possible for this to differ between seller. Certain artists may also receive an additional sales commission apart from the imposed 2.5 percentage.
In addition, trading on Etheruem is costly. Your NFT collection will be minted as a valid token that is non-fungible after your NFT bid is accepted. The cost of the process will vary based on the market, but you can anticipate that it will be around $100 per NFT.
You also need to know that some NFTs have extra commissions. For instance, game developers are paid 15 percent or more commissions for items they’ve sold.
What are the payment methods?
OpenSea cannot accept conventional currencies like US Dollar or Euros. You’ll need to set up your crypto wallet. This is where you’ll convert your cryptocurrencies into cash. Also, you are not able to use PayPal credit, debit, or debit cards for payment for or deposit. Week 1 Nft Lines
The NFTs can only be purchased or traded only if the cryptocurrency you’re using is accepted by OpenSea. Here’s a list with cryptocurrency wallets and blockchains that they support.
Blockchains Supported by OpenSea
- Klatyn
- Ethereum
- Polygon
Wallets Supported by OpenSea
- Portis
- Fortmatic/Magic
- MetaMask
- Arkane
- Coinbase
- WalletLink
- TrustWallet
- Dapper
- Torus
- Authereum
- OperaTouch
- Bitski
- WalletConnect
- Kaikas
